Html element resize event. An instance of an HTML &l...

Html element resize event. An instance of an HTML <object> element creates Withing CSS element queries implementations, same as with @media queries you define discreet breakpoints where you apply new rule, as opposed to a continuous event firing in the Javascript On resize events (debounced), you can easily get the current layout type by querying the window object. It appears that altering the dimensions of a canvas clears any drawing already done on that canvas. trigger() simulates an event activation, complete with a synthesized event object, it does not perfectly replicate a naturally-occurring event. This might be a single element, a set of elements, the HTML document loaded in the current tab, or There is a very efficient method to determine if an element's size has been changed. In some earlier browsers it was possible to register resize event handlers on any HTML element. You should better assign a new event handler to the resize event using event listener, as shown in the example above. Enhance website interactivity with EventTarget事件 - resize调整文档视图(窗口)的大小时将触发resize事件。在某些早期的浏览器中,可以在任何HTML元素上注册resize事件处理程序。仍然可以设置onresize属性或使用addEventListener Use this approach for single HTML elements that you wish to react to resize. It is similar to the HTML DOM onresize event but uses the camelCase convention in Событие resize срабатывает при изменении размера представления документа (окна). In this part we will be looking at how to use the resize 301 Moved Permanently 301 Moved Permanently nginx The onresize event in JavaScript generally occurs when the window has been resized. La propriété onresize,rattachée au mixin GlobalEventHandlers, est un gestionnaire d'évènements qui permet de traiter les évènements resize. The resize event in jQuery triggers when the browser window or an element is resized. onresize or using window. The Resize Observer API provides a performant mechanism by which code can monitor an element for changes to its size, with notifications being delivered to the observer each time the size changes. In some earlier browsers it was possible to register An event handler can be registered for the resize event using attribute window. Below, we will walk through how to resize an HTML element This shows that you can respond to changes in an element's size, even if they have nothing to do with the viewport. - mdn/content 所以还是要寻找更优的解决方法。 最终通过google以及 GitHub,找到了一款名为detect-element-resize-master的插件,通过该插件我们我们就可以对element实 This tutorial will introduce you to the OnResize event, what it does and when to use it. onresize = function(){myScript}; 亲自试一试 在 JavaScript 中,使用 addEventListener () 方法: The change event is fired for <input>, <select>, and <textarea> elements when the user modifies the element's value. net/vxun2Lgg/2/ I've attached a resize event listener on container div. The 'window resize' event in JavaScript is triggered when the size of the browser window changes. From part one, we learnt how we can get and set the height of an element in JavaScript and jQuery. Discover the best practices for listening to window resize events in JavaScript without relying on jQuery. Prior to the introduction of the Resize Observer API in I'm writing an Angular2 component that needs to dynamically change its content when resized. you have a navigation bar . Tip: To get the size of an element, use the clientWidth, clientHeight, innerWidth, innerHeight, outerWidth, outerHeight, . 0) and can wire up a click listener with the The resize CSS property sets whether an element is resizable, and if so, in which directions. I am using the experimental Renderer in @angular/core (v2. E. This allows you to position elements relative to the visual viewport as it is zoomed, which would normally be If I have this window. Or we can use the ResizeObserver constructor to create an object that lets us watch an element for resizing. A comprehensive guide to the CSS resize property, detailing how to control the resizability of HTML elements and enhance user interaction. trigger (): This library function allows us to trigger both native and customized events. Since I want to execute different logic when resizing elements and when the window gets resized, is th To limit how often your resize code is called, you can use the debounce or throttle methods from the underscore & lodash libraries. The method can be used independently or can be launched by another event. Home to over 14,000 pages of documentation about HTML, CSS, JS, HTTP, Web APIs, and more. . Then you can compare the layout type with the former layout type, and if it has changed, re-render Looks like that when resizing an HTML element, the windows' resize event gets fired as well. There is div resize event for elements in JavaScript. I am not talking about an elements being drag/dropped. Elevate user experience with HTML onresize attributes, defining actions when the browser window or element is resized. I'm writing a component decorator that is able to detect when a DOM element's size is altered (by css, javascript, window resize etc). 一部の初期のブラウザーでは、 resize イベントのハンドラーをすべての HTML 要素に設定することができました。 現在でも onresize 属性や addEventListener() を使用して、どの要素にもハンドラー From part one, we learnt how we can get and set the height of an element in JavaScript and jQuery. To get the size of the window use: Definition and Usage The onresize attribute fires when the browser window is resized. Is there an event that fires on canvas resize, so I can hook it and redraw when it occurs? The ability to respond to changes in the size of elements within a webpage is crucial for creating a dynamic and responsive user experience. You can view demo and download the source code. Instead, developers can leverage the window object's resize event within the useEffect() hook to handle resizing events. trigger('resize'); And has the caveat: Although . This event is not cancelable and does not bubble. Dieses Ereignis kann nicht abgebrochen werden und propagiert nicht. It allows us to execute JavaScript code in response to this event, There’s also another use case for the Resize Observer API that the window’s resize event can’t help us with: when elements are added or removed from the DOM dynamically, influencing the size of the In some earlier browsers it was possible to register resize event handlers on any HTML element. $(window). The W3Schools online code editor allows you to edit code and view the result in your browser The resize event of the HTMLVideoElement interface fires when one or both of the videoWidth and videoHeight properties have just been updated. The HTML DOM onresize event occurs on the browser window resize. addEventListener('resize', ) In some earlier browsers it was possible to register resize Resizing elements in web development is an essential feature to create dynamic and responsive user interfaces. To get the size of the window, we can use the JavaScript&#39;s window. The window resize event is triggered whenever the browser window is resized by the user. $ (<element>). In this case, we will use Events are fired inside the browser window, and tend to be attached to a specific item that resides in it. Unlike the input event, the change event is not necessarily fired for each alteration Take a look at this example: https://jsfiddle. In some earlier browsers it was possible to register The resize event fires when the user resizes the browser window or a resizable element. To get the size of the window use: clientWidth, Elevate user experience with HTML onresize attributes, defining actions when the browser window or element is resized. This tutorial covers examples and best practices. Here is a free code snippet to create a JavaScript Element Resize Event. Learn how to use the onresize event to handle browser window resizing in JavaScript. A detailed guide to the JavaScript onresize event, explaining how to detect and respond to window resizing, with practical examples and tips. It is still possible to set onresize attributes or use addEventListener() to set a handler on any element. What you can to is to intercept the user interaction to build your own listener, like this: Window: resize event The resize event fires when the document view (window) has been resized. We can add a resize event using the addEventListener() and onresize() function in JavaScript. In some earlier browsers it was possible to register Currently all major browser doesn't support a resize event for html-element's, just for the window object. If you’re used to something like jQuery UI resizeable, you get events you can bind to during the resizing, but also at the end of resizing. debounce will only execute your resize code X number of milliseconds We can listen to resize events by assigning a resize event listener to the window object. The <body> HTML tag is the only one supported by the onresize event which is triggered only when the window instance that "body" belongs to is resized. After opening up dev tools, and modifying the width of container, resize callback Method 1: Using resize event We can add an event listener to the body element which fires whenever the window size is resized. Window: resize event The resize event fires when the document view (window) has been resized. 1. The resize event of the HTMLVideoElement interface fires when one or both of the videoWidth and videoHeight properties have just been updated. You can listen to window resizing with the window's resize event The onresize event attribute is triggered each time when resizing the browser window size. onresize = function () { alert ('resized!!'); }; My function gets fired multiple times throughout the resize, but I want to capture the completion of the resize. See examples, syntax, browser support, and technical details of this event. There is no direct element resize event support in JavaScript. This event can be used to dynamically adjust the layout, resize elements, or alter styles as necessary to The W3Schools online code editor allows you to edit code and view the result in your browser I'd like to know if there is a DOM event to listen for that tells me when a DOM element moves is repositioned or is resized on the page. It is still possible to set onresize attributes or use addEventListener() to. By default, there are no built-in events that monitor element resize events. We also provide a checkbox to turn the observer off and on. We'll also talk about some common uses for the OnResize event. No such event exists in native JavaScript. In einigen älteren Browsern war es möglich, resize -Ereignishandler für jedes HTML-Element zu registrieren. 本教程是onresize 事件基础知识,您将学习如何使用onresize 事件附完整代码示例与在线练习,适合初学者入门。 The resize event of the VisualViewport interface is fired when the visual viewport is resized. Learn about the HTML onresize event attribute, its usage, and how to implement it effectively in your web projects. 12 Mozilla Docs says: "Any element can be given an onresize attribute, however only the window object has a resize event. With JavaScript, developers can allow users to resize elements in real-time, enhancing Resizing the window is an event that a ResizeObserver can capture by definition, but calling appendChild() also resizes that element (unless overflow: hidden is The HTML DOM onresize event occurs on the browser window resize. But most responsive implementations will use the more reliable window resize event. g. dispatchEvent (myEvent); 二、js触发页面resize事件 博客对应课程的视频位置: 1 div のリサイズを拾う方法のメモ。 resizeイベントは、divなどの要素では発火しません。。。windowのリサイズなら発火するのですが。。。 そこで、要素のリ The official source for MDN Web Docs content. But I am now more interested to do in a general The resize event is fired when the document view has been resized. resize () method to bind an event handler to the JavaScript resize event optionally passing an object of data or trigger that event on the specified element. Example: This example shows The resize event is fired when the document view has been resized. It is more optimal than using a window resize event. 21 What should the best practices to listen on element resize event? I want to re-position an element (jQuery dialog in my case), once it's size changed. Only the <body> tag support this event. Please check out the tutorial on JavaScript event listeners to learn more about it. The ResizeObserver constructor creates a new ResizeObserver object, which can be used to report changes to the content or border box of an Element or the bounding box of an SVGElement. The change in a div's dimension can be detected using 2 approaches: Method 1: Checking for changes using the ResizeObserver Interface The ResizeObserver Size changes caused by added elements: the Resize Observer API can help us react to size changes of an element that are triggered because of the dynamic js触发页面resize事件 一、总结 一句话总结: 1、let myEvent = new Event ('resize'); 2、window. It enables developers to execute code in response to resizing actions, Window: resize event The resize event fires when the document view (window) has been resized. It is still possible to set onresize attributes or use addEventListener() to set a handler on Learn how to use the onresize event to handle browser window resizing in JavaScript. Enhance website interactivity with Element resize events can be useful for certain widgets like textareas that reflow as the user types. It already works perfectly, I'm now trying to make its API eas 301 Moved Permanently 301 Moved Permanently nginx Description The onresize event occurs when the browser window has been resized. It is generally used for responsive design, dynamically Specifically, you can listen to events like mousedown, mousemove, and mouseup to implement a drag-to-resize feature. Resizing other elements (say by modifying the width or height of an img element 在 HTML 中: <element onresize="myScript"> 亲自试一试 在 JavaScript 中: object. You can fake it by setting a resize イベントはブラウザのウィンドウサイズが変更されたときに発生するイベントです。 onresize プロパティに対してイベントハンドラを設定したり、 Viget is a full-service interactive agency that helps plan, design, build, and measure successful websites and digital products. EventTarget事件 - resize调整文档视图(窗口)的大小时将触发resize事件。在某些早期的浏览器中,可以在任何HTML元素上注册resize事件处理程序。仍然可以设置onresize属性或使用addEventListener Explore different methods to trigger the window resize event in JavaScript, making your application responsive and interactive. Es ist immer noch Learn how to use the jQuery resize event to handle window resizing in your web applications. In this short article, we would like to show how to monitor size changes of div (or any element) in pure JavaScript. In this part we will be looking at how to use the resize . macqz, 515aj, 6vmho, byjna, 7enyx, 9bv9e, trt1, pkewt, txsx, rvyanh,